MMS settings are another matter tbh, not just as simple as putting the settings in. Ring up O2 while your SIM is in the C905 and ask them that you need them to enable MMS on your profile as you wanna be able to use it to send picture messages (obviously with the iPhone, MMS support is not available) It can be a bit of a 'to and fro' affair, some people have had to call them multiple times to get it sorted, so depends on how much you want MMS to work!
